Safeguarding Property Value

Beyond the immediate impact on guest satisfaction, smoking prohibitions in vacation rentals also safeguard property value over the long term. Smoking indoors can result in pervasive odors, stubborn stains, and damage to furnishings, all of which detract from the aesthetic appeal and marketability of the property. Over time, these effects can necessitate costly repairs and renovations, eroding the property’s value and profitability.

This study from the early-2000’s concluded that smoking prohibitions do increase appeal and value in a vacation home. As the researchers wrote, “Most significantly, our results reveal that vacationers are willing to pay substantial additional rent for properties that prohibit smoking.”

Additionally, smoking-related incidents pose significant fire hazards, placing both guests and property at risk. By enforcing smoking prohibitions, vacation rental owners mitigate these risks and demonstrate a commitment to maintaining a safe and secure environment for guests. This proactive approach not only protects the property from potential damage but also minimizes liability and insurance costs associated with smoking-related incidents.

Furthermore, as public awareness of the health hazards of smoking continues to grow, properties that embrace smoke-free policies are perceived as more desirable and socially responsible. This positive reputation can enhance the property’s appeal to prospective guests and investors alike, further bolstering its value in the competitive vacation rental market.

Promoting Environmental Sustainability

In addition to benefiting guests and property owners, smoking prohibitions in vacation rentals contribute to broader environmental sustainability efforts. Cigarette butts, one of the most common forms of litter, pose a significant threat to ecosystems, wildlife, and waterways when improperly disposed of. By eliminating smoking on the premises, vacation rental properties reduce the likelihood of cigarette litter and its associated environmental impact.

Moreover, smoking prohibitions align with global initiatives to combat climate change and reduce air pollution. Tobacco smoke contains numerous harmful chemicals and particulate matter that can linger in indoor spaces, compromising air quality and posing health risks to occupants. By maintaining smoke-free environments, vacation rental properties support cleaner indoor air and contribute to the well-being of guests and staff alike.

Furthermore, smoke-free policies encourage responsible behavior and promote a culture of environmental stewardship among guests. By raising awareness of the environmental consequences of smoking and encouraging sustainable practices, vacation rental properties can inspire positive change and foster a greater sense of community among guests.
